How our sorting works

The order in which job vacancies are displayed is determined by a composite score based on the following factors:

  • Keyword Relevance: How well your search terms match the vacancy details. We prioritize matches found in the job title, followed by job requirements, location names, and educational levels. Matches within general employer information or the organization's name carry a lower weight.
  • Commercial Prioritization (Premium Jobs): Vacancies paid for by employers ('Premium' or 'Sponsored') receive a ranking boost and will appear higher in the search results.
  • Recency (Date Relevance): Newer vacancies are prioritized. The relevance score of a vacancy is reduced by half once the posting is older than 30 days.
  • Proximity (Distance Relevance): Vacancies located closer to your search location are ranked higher. For vacancies located more than 30 km from the search center, the relevance score is halved.
The final ranking is established by multiplying all these individual factors to calculate the total relevance score.

    Job description

    An opportunity has arisen within our catering team section for a Permanent catering Assistant, based at our Training & Development centre in Handsworth, Sheffield.

    Catering Assistant
    Location: SYFR Training and Development Centre, Handsworth, Sheffield S13 9QA
    Hours: Part Time, 20 hours per week (Flexible working hours)
    Contract: Permanent
    Salary: £25,949 per annum, pro rata (Grade 3) *To increase subject to national pay award negotiations for 2026.

    The overall purpose of the role will be to undertake the preparation of food, serving of food, putting away stock and rotation of stock. There will also be general kitchen and dining room duties, including cleaning, setting up and clearing away equipment and tables. You will be expected to carry out food safety procedures. The role will include using a till and cash handling and reconciliation.

    To be considered for this role you will have previous experience of working in a canteen or similar environment and familiar with food allergies.

    Ideally you must possess the basic food hygiene certificate – if not, training will be provided.

    The key duties will include:

    * Preparation and serving of food

    * General kitchen and dining room duties, including cleaning, setting up and clearing away equipment and tables.

    * To carry out food safety procedures.

    * The role will involve stock putting away and rotation.

    * The role will include using till and cash handling and reconciliation.

    New starters will commence on the bottom of the salary grade and will receive increases to the top of the grade on an incremental basis. We offer 28 days annual leave (pro-rata) plus Bank Holidays. Annual leave increases after 5 years’ service to 32 days, followed by an extra day a year up to a maximum of 37 days. We also operate a generous flexi time attendance scheme.

    Most of our corporate roles offer flexi time and agile working, meaning people can vary their hours to suit their commitments outside of work as agreed with their line manager. Flexi time can be accrued with a potential of up to 13 days to be taken within a year.

    All eligible corporate staff are auto-enrolled onto the Local Government Pension Scheme with contributions ranging from 5.5% to 12.5%. It is a defined benefit pension scheme that means pensions are based on salary and the length of paying into the scheme. 1/49th of your pensionable salary is added to your pot per year plus cost of living adjustments. Further information on the scheme, and additional benefits, can be found on the LGPS website.

    Other benefits include (but not limited to) – enhanced sick pay, access to free on-site gyms, a cycle 2 work scheme, access to emergency services discounts across a wide variety of popular companies, enhanced maternity and paternity schemes and the opportunity to join the TransaveUK credit union.
